- [ ] **Step 7: Breaker override escrow.** After sealing the signing keys for the Tallgrove upstream API circuit breaker, confirm the support team can force the breaker open during a full outage. The override bundle lives in the sealed escrow drawer and is useless without its unlock phrase. Two ceremony witnesses must initial this step before proceeding. The escrow bundle is decrypted with the recovery passphrase that follows.

vault phrase of kahip-kahop = holath-quenmir

Action item from the Millgrave incident: the Sparrowcheck typo-squatting scanner missed two lookalike packages because its edit-distance threshold was too strict. Threshold has been lowered and a manual review queue added. Support: if a customer reports a suspicious package, do not advise uninstalling until scanned. File findings through the triage page below.

runbook for kahap-yageg: https://sentry.merlaqgrid.corp/issue/deploy/dash/job/56a2db96e11ebc18

Migration step 5: cutover the solver

Switch Chalkline's timetable solver from the legacy branch-and-bound engine to the new constraint core. Stop the scheduler, drain pending solve jobs, then deploy the new image. Re-run the Ashgrove Academy regression suite before re-enabling intake; if any timetable differs from the golden set, roll back immediately and page the solver team. Expect solve times to drop roughly 40%. Do not tune heuristics during cutover. After deploy, verify the solver picked up the values listed below.

deployment values, kajep-kageg:
[praix]
host = praix.paliqcorp.corp
user = praix_svc
database = praix_prod

Runbook: Scanline barcode bridge

If warehouse scans stop flowing into Cartwheel, it's almost always the bridge service on the Dunmore floor box wedging after a USB hiccup. Bounce the service first — nine times out of ten that fixes it. If not, check the queue depth before escalating. When restarting, make sure the bridge comes up with these settings.

deployment values, yafop-bajef:
[gilok]
team = ulaius
access_code = ac_423664
host = gilok.sivrelhq.corp
port = 9200
owner = pelius.istax
peer = eliok.torvasoft.internal